CM69UpdateBin-style update packages provide a reliable, auditable way to deliver firmware and system updates across device fleets, combining manifest-driven orchestration, cryptographic verification, and atomic flashing semantics. Proper design emphasizes integrity checks, rollback protection, minimal trusted execution for signature verification, and staged rollouts for safety.
